M-System

The M-System is a versatile data acquisition and analysis unit. It synchronously collects data from several connected accelerometers and sensors and transfers the analysed information, including alarms, to the TCM® software platform.

  • Up to 24 synchronous channels
  • Remotely operated
  • Robust to network outages
  • Software selectable gain
  • Excellent dynamic range

M-Sensors

The M-Sensor is an intelligent sensor with built-in digital signal analysis that boasts of advanced motion monitoring capabilities at low system costs. The sensor is ideal for tower sway monitoring and structural vibration.

  • Four versatile vibration guards
  • Fastest possible response time
  • Relay and level output
  • Motion pattern analysis
  • Built-in signal processing

Accelerometers

The accelerometers are sensors mounted in the most crucial drive train locations. The accelerometers used as part of the TCM® solution are fast shock recovery, meaning that you will never miss a signal. 

  • Rapid shock recovery
  • Rugged design
  • Corrosion-resistant
  • Hermetic seal
  • Case isolated
